Kewaunee's Cullen, Miller lead local runners at De Pere Invite

Several local teams participated in one of the biggest meets to kick off the season on the campus of UW-Green Bay for the De Pere Invitational.

 

Over 200 kids participated in each of the two varsity races with Kewaunee runners finishing ahead of its local competitors. Sophomore Hannah Miller broke 20 minutes for a personal record of 19:58 to take fourth overall. Senior Christopher Cullen also set a personal record on the 5K course, running a time of 17:16 for a top 20 performance.

The Sturgeon Bay girls cross country team posted another strong performance on Thursday at the Green Bay Preble Tom Finlan Memorial Invitaitonal at Josten Park. Julia Kurek led the Clippers once again in the 5K distance, completing the course in a time of 21:33 to come in sixth place overall. The Clippers scored 100 points, finishing behind first place Green Bay Preble (21 points) and Bonduel (55 points. Luke Selle paced the boys on the 5K course, running a time of 24:51.
